Campaign and its execution courtesy social samosa The campaign ran for only three days where the brand engaged with the target

audience, tremendously, via the 6 influencers. Each influencer was assigned an individual hash tag named after the 6 color variants of the car. The common hash tag to be used was #NanoBiddingWar.

Once the campaign was in place, all the brand had to do was amplify the individual activities and conversations that the influencers were engaging in. Besides that, it posted scores regularly on who stood where as far as the number of ‘bids’ were concerned.

All 6 influencers kept tweeting for three days to the target audience in an attempt to win the car. Their efforts were vigorous and evident, increasing the brand’s appeal.

In the process, the top supporters would get miniature versions of the car that were signed by Bollywood movie stars. This provided a great boost and an incentive to all the users on Twitter.
